What data led to the development of the Law of Multiple Proportions? Give an example and explain why this law is important in chemistry.
Would this be a good answer:
John Dalton used the same observations he used for his law of definite proportions to help develop the law of multiple proportions, in other words, he used masses of samples to help create the law. An example would be CO2 and CO, both made of the same elements yet have different masses. the mass ratio of O2 to C in CO2 is 2.67:1 , but in CO the ratio is 1.33:1. When we divide 2.67 by 1.33 we get 2- meaning that for every 2 O2, there is 1 C atom. This law is important because it helps it helps find the proportions of compounds made with the same of elements.
